Ch. 203

2003 LAWS OF MARYLAND

(6)     Notwithstanding any other provision in this subsection, moneys may
not be expended from the [Fund] ACCOUNT until the balance in the [Fund]
ACCOUNT has reached $15,000,000.

(7)     (i) The [Fund] ACCOUNT shall be used on a statewide basis to
meet the emergency needs of economically disadvantaged citizens of the State.

(ii) Moneys from the [Fund] ACCOUNT may not be considered the
sole source of funds to meet the emergency needs of economically disadvantaged
citizens of the State.

(iii) The [Fund] ACCOUNT shall be used only for programs and
services that:

1. serve children in need;

2. provide health services to individuals in need who are at
or below 150% of the federal poverty level; and

3. provide food or shelter assistance to individuals in need.

(8)     The [Fund] ACCOUNT may not be used to supplant existing public
and private expenditures, unless the Department of Labor, Licensing, and Regulation
makes the certification under paragraph (5) of this subsection and reductions in
public and private expenditures warrant supplantation.

(9)     Expenditures from the [Fund] ACCOUNT may be:

(i) included in the State budget subject to appropriation by the
General Assembly; or

(ii) made by budget amendment to the expenditure account of the
appropriate unit of State government only after the proposed budget amendment has
been submitted to the Senate Budget and Taxation Committee and the House
Appropriations Committee of the General Assembly.

(10)   Notwithstanding any other provision of this subsection, for fiscal
years 2002, 2003, and 2004, expenditures from the [Fund] ACCOUNT may be made
only as follows:

(i) for fiscal year 2002, moneys may not be expended from the
[Fund] ACCOUNT;

(ii) for fiscal year 2003, subject to the budget amendment procedure
provided for in § 7-209 of this title, up to $3,300,000 from the [Fund] ACCOUNT may
be used for the Department of Human Resources to cover costs associated with
increasing temporary cash assistance grants effective January 1, 2003; and

(iii) for fiscal year 2004, as included in the State budget or subject to
the budget amendment procedure provided for in § 7-209 of this title, the remaining
balance in the [Fund] ACCOUNT may be used for the Department of Human
Resources to cover costs associated with increasing temporary cash assistance grants
effective January 1, 2003.
